Abstract

This study aims to produce a technology-based innovation product in the form of an Arduino-based Waste ATM that can automatically receive and manage plastic bottle waste to help increase public awareness and participation in recycling waste management. The research method used is research and development or Research & Development (R&D) which adapts the ADDIE development model which consists of 5 (five) stages, namely 1.) Analyze; 2.) Design; 3.) Development; and 4.) Implementation; and 5.) Evaluation. Based on the results of the research that has been carried out, it was found that the Arduino-based waste ATM system has been successfully designed and tested as a solution in automatically managing plastic bottle waste. The implementation of this system uses a capacitive proximity sensor and an ultrasonic sensor that functions to detect the type of material and the volume or size of the waste. In its application, there are several obstacles that need to be considered, such as the setting of the capacitive proximity sensor in recognizing non-plastic waste which causes the system to sometimes be able to process it. Therefore, to improve the effectiveness of the system in supporting public awareness of waste recycling, further optimization is needed such as the integration of additional sensors or the development of more adaptive algorithms.

Abstract

This study aims to obtain an overview of students’ conceptual understanding on colloidal materials by applying the flipped classroom integrated with peer-instruction. The research method used is qualitative method. This research was conducted at SMA Negeri 8 Depok in the even semester of the 2021/2022 academic year. The research subjects were students of class XI IPA 3 which amounted to 39 students. Research data were collected from observation sheets, reflective journals, researcher notes, conceptual understanding sheets, conceptual understanding test, and interviews. In this study, to analyze the categories of students’ conceptual understanding level used categories adapted from Abraham et al. (1992), namely understanding, lack of understanding, misconceptions, not understanding, and no response. Learning was conducted face-to-face used flipped classroom integrated peer-instruction. The flipped classroom integrated peer-instruction learning model consist of three stages, namely pre-class learning, in-class learning, and after-class learning. During in-class learning, students were given a ConcepTest. The percentage of ConcepTest results was 30% - 70% so that learning continued with group discussion. In all colloidal sub-materials, the majority of students were in the “understand” category with an average percentage of 60,17%. The conclusion of this study is that the flipped classroom learning model integrated with peer-instruction can help students develop students’ conceptual understanding of colloidal material. The integrated flipped classroom and peer instruction can be an alternative in learning activities to develop students’ conceptual understanding.

Abstract

This study presents a comprehensive bibliometric analysis of the scholarly literature on the impact of social tech hubs on social innovation and local economic development. Using data from the Scopus database and analytical tools such as VOSviewer, the study explores co-authorship networks, keyword co-occurrences, citation patterns, and thematic clusters. Results indicate that “social innovation” is the central concept in this domain, frequently associated with themes such as sustainable development, social entrepreneurship, and digital transformation. The field demonstrates a shift from earlier emphasis on open innovation and corporate responsibility to more recent interests in digital social innovation and sustainability goals. Leading contributors are concentrated in Europe, North America, and Australia, though there is growing representation from Asia, Latin America, and Africa. The findings highlight both the growing complexity and interdisciplinarity of the field, as well as its structural gaps—particularly in rural development, governance, and Global South collaboration. This study provides valuable insights for researchers, policymakers, and practitioners seeking to understand the evolving role of social tech hubs in advancing inclusive and sustainable innovation ecosystems.

Abstract

Small islands possess considerable ecological and economic potential, particularly in the management of forest resources. However, unsustainable forest management practices frequently undermine the integrity and resilience of these ecosystems. Implementing zoning strategies, specifically through the establishment of utilization zones, presents a viable solution for promoting the sustainable use of forest resources. This study analyzes the vegetation structure within the utilization zone of Nusalaut Island, which is located at elevations ranging from 0 to 100 meters above sea level and is characterized by intensive activities such as forest resource exploitation and plantation development. The primary objectives of this research are to assess the Importance Value Index (IVI) and evaluate species diversity across different vegetation strata within the utilization zone. A combined transect and grid sampling method was employed, and data analysis utilized standard vegetation assessment techniques to calculate IVI and species diversity indices. The results reveal that the forest vegetation in the Nusalaut utilization zone comprises four growth stages: seedlings, saplings, poles, and mature trees, with species composition varying across strata and villages. The highest species richness was observed in the seedling stage (16 species in Ameth and Akoon), sapling stage (17 species in Abubu and Ameth), pole stage (18 species in Titawai), and tree stage (20 species in Akoon). The calculated IVI values varied significantly across growth stages, indicating a heterogeneous distribution of dominant species. Overall, species diversity within the utilization zone of Nusalaut Island is classified as moderate, reflecting a relatively balanced yet potentially vulnerable ecosystem that necessitates careful management to ensure the sustainability of its ecological functions.

Abstract

The aim of this research is to determine the teaching factory (TEFA) learning process in industrial technology-based Vocational High Schools (SMK), which includes: 1) Learning planning, 2) learning implementation process, and 3) Learning outcomes. The type of research used is qualitative research with a descriptive approach. Data collection methods used include direct observation at schools, in-depth interviews and documentation. The data analysis technique used in this research is Miles Huberman (1992) which includes: data reduction, data presentation, drawing conclusions and verification. The results found in the research show that: 1) planning has been implemented well, this can be seen through analysis of the previous TEFA learning process, 2) implementation has been good, this is proven by the availability of competent human resources, good cooperation with DUDI, but the facilities and infrastructure are still inadequate; 3) The results of the implementation are good, this is proven by the products created in productive subject learning at the school. Abstract

Global warming has become a crucial issue that requires concrete action from all layers of society. One effort that can be made is greening through planting fruit trees that not only absorb carbon dioxide but also provide economic benefits. This community service activity aims to improve the knowledge and skills of the people of Negeri Uren, Leihitu District, Central Maluku Regency in grafting techniques as a method of vegetative propagation of fruit plants. Implementation of activities includes counseling about global warming and the importance of greening, training in grafting techniques, mentoring and monitoring, as well as strengthening entrepreneurial capacity. The results of the activity showed a significant increase in the knowledge and skills of participants, with more than 90% of participants able to understand the concept and 80% able to practice grafting techniques correctly. This activity also produced 25 grafted plants and increased community understanding about grafted plant nurseries. Factors driving the success of the program include support from local government, enthusiasm of participants, potential natural resources, availability of materials and tools, as well as collaboration of the service team. Meanwhile, inhibiting factors include time limitations, variations in participants' understanding levels, limitations of plant types for practice, language barriers, and unpredictable weather. For program sustainability, continuous assistance, advanced training, diversification of plant types, development of marketing networks, and integration with government programs are needed.

Abstract

(Title: Kaba Lamamang Tanjung Ampalu: a Search for Local Wisdom). Kaba is a type of oral literature typical of the West Sumatra region, ethnic Minangkabau. Kaba is a story told by a Kabaist with accompaniment of fiddle music. Kaba's literary strength is largely determined by the ability of the Kabaist. Kaba Lamang Tanjung Ampalu is played by Hasan Basril, one of the interesting research subjects to study. Issues of value or local wisdom in Kaba Lamang Tanjung Ampalu are considered interesting and need to be raised. The reason, Kaba as oral literature and values of life as a social phenomenon become an interrelated element. As a human's creation, Kaba will convey the values contained to the audience, so that Kaba can influence the listener's mindset. This reasoning is in accordance with the opinion of Wallek and Warren (1989) that in literature (Kaba) there is a value of life. The descriptive analytical research method explains the meaning of the contents of symbolic interactions that occur in communication events so that the contents of Kaba can be understood appropriately. As a result, this study shows that there are 7 local wisdoms in Kaba Lamang Tanjung Ampalu; the value of local wisdom relates to livelihoods, equipment, values of knowledge, religious systems, arts, social systems, and language and literature.Keywords: kaba, local wisdom, Minangkabau ethnicity

Abstract

Abstract: Vocational education plays an important role in preparing students to enter the workplace with relevant expertise. In today's digital age, the use of information and communication technology (ICT) has become a must to improve learning efficiency in vocational education institutions. This article aims to explore how the use of technology can improve the learning experience of students in vocational schools. Literature studies are a series of research activities involving the collection, reading, recording, and processing of information from relevant written sources. As an example of a case study, we will review how vocational schools have successfully improved learning by using an online learning platform. With this platform, students can access learning materials, tasks, and exams online, as well as interact with teachers and fellow students through available discussion and collaboration features. The evaluation results showed significant improvements in student participation, material understanding, and overall academic results. The use of technology has brought a major change in the learning process in vocational schools. With careful planning and robust support, technology can be an effective tool in enhancing students’ learning experiences, preparing them to face the challenges of an increasingly complex world of work, and enhancing their competitiveness in a dynamic global job market. Keywords: Vocational education, Information and Communication Technology, Online Learning PlatformDOI: 10.23960/jmmp.v12.i2.2024.32158
